What is the big deal here? Has everyone forgot what the the "Echo" buff is? and how it works?
when 2.2 comes out and more turns of coil are released, when you enter turns 1-5 its the exact same fight as it is now. The buff activates after X number of wipes, adding HP and DMG and def to the members of the group, making it easier. keep failing get more stacks and larger buffs till you can finish the content. Dont want the buff but still wiping? well, exit and re-enter and the buff will be gone, or they may add an option to remove it. Thus they have not destroyed the current content, but as it is "old" and not top tier rewards anymore it is made more available to the hole playerbase.
The "echo" buff has been in game since Open Beta for story quests (most people have never encountered it), but go play on a new char and do some story quests and die a few times and see the buff. All they are doing is adding this same buffing mechanic to "old" content to make it killable by people who are not able to now after they fail some, making it easier each few tries until they are buffed enough to kill it. Now will people abuse this and wipe 10 times for a big buff then actually attempt to kill it? some will, but it still allows many to do it in its original difficulty, something that many MMO's screw up for new players because they actually nerfed the content.
